The answer to your question is:

m∠a = 44°, m∠b = 47° and  m∠c = 89°

∠a and ∠b are not complementary angles

Step-by-step explanation:

Process

1.- m∠a + m∠b + m∠c = 180° because they are supplementary angles.

       (3x + 5) + (5x - 18) + (7x - 2) = 180°

2.- Simplify like terms

       3x + 5 + 5x - 18 + 7x - 2 = 180°

       3x + 5x + 7x = 180 - 5 + 18 + 2

       15 x = 195

           x = 195 / 15

          x = 13

3.- Determine m∠a, m∠b and m∠c.

    m∠a = 3(13) + 5

             = 39 + 5

            = 44°

    m∠b = 5(13) - 18

             = 47°

    m∠c = 7(13) - 2

            = 89°    

Part B. ∠ a and ∠ b are not complementary angles, because the sum of these angles equals 90° and the sum of ∠a + ∠b = 91°.
